16 Friday - March 1973
75th Day - 290 Days to Come


To Simulations. Met with Bob Champer. Discussed my idea for the PATTON mechanism. He pointed out, and I checked, that the dice use was a little similar to that in QUÉBEC 1759. But not enough to worry about. [illegible word crossed out]
We agreed that he would work on "The Battle of the Bulge" while I worked on "Sicily." We'll get together next week and check them out. Then we'll work on "France" together.
Bob found a history of World War I and II for me. I reproduced the section on "Sicily." // Gave Bob check for $50.
Phil F. gave me copies of: AUSTERLITZ, MUSKET & PIKE, KOREA, RIFLE & SABER, AMERICAN REVOLUTION. (Later discovered that I already had AMERICAN REVOLUTION.) In RIFLE & SABER the "Turn Record Chart" seems to be missing, also in MUSKET & PIKE.*
Ran off 3 repros [reproductions] of a game I found on the bulletin board - AWOL - A GAME FOR LOSERS.
Sal talked to me about a game idea he had - RIP-OFF. He spoke to Jim D. about it and if they take it it will be for a flat fee. Sal once spoke to Phil Orbanes about it and Phil was interested at that time in working with him. I said I'd check with Phil (but I forgot when we did get together).
Took a copy of S&T to give to Phil.

To Felicia's. Gave her $30 check for PATTON. Looked at LOTTERY and it was in good shape. Looked at MAVERICK COUNTRY and decided that it really wasn't good enough to show to Lakeside. She appreciated my decision. She thought the name LADY LUCK was O.K.

To "Gamut of Games," Played I Went over my corrections in REALM and INFINITY. Phil made notes and also kept the copies I marked up. He'll fix them up and then get them to me for a final check.
Played INFINITY with Phil, Djoli, and Nick.
BB rcd. [received] a call from someone in a school and gave her my number at "Gamut." She is setting up a career conference at the Jr. H.S. [Junior Highschool] (I believe) and wanted me to talk about career opportunities in Games. (She got my name from Mike Albers.) I told her that I really didn't know about opportunities in game companies and that I would have to be very negative about free-lancing. She thanked me.
Phil made out a contract for my work on REALM - 3¢ a game. He wanted to put a 5-year cut-off on the contract, but Djoli said 5 years.
Went with Djoli to visit Waddimir Waldimir Van Zedwitz (Wad Waldy Waldy). Supper at the Carlyle Hotel. Then to Djoli's room to test MONTAGE with Nick a girl friend of his. Wally kibitzed. Played one game and part of a second, but I had to go back to the office to get my things, I left them there thinking we were coming back.
